I have a 295x2 amd card. I set the options bellow obviously removing personal info

EthDcrMiner64.exe -epool eth-eu1.nanopool.org:9999 -ewal 0xwallet/PC1/abc@123.com -epsw x -etht 1000 -mode 1 -ftime 10

Log shows these last few lines:

13:29:48:384 4b88 parse packet: 242
13:29:48:387 4b88 ETH: job is the same
13:29:48:389 4b88 new buf size: 0
13:29:49:848 47a4 Setting DAG epoch #115 for GPU #0
13:29:49:851 47a4 Create GPU buffer for GPU #0
13:29:49:851 2610 Setting DAG epoch #115 for GPU #1
13:29:49:856 2610 Create GPU buffer for GPU #1

From Event Viewer:

Faulting application name: EthDcrMiner64.exe, version: 0.0.0.0, time stamp: 0x58c7fc9f
Faulting module name: EthDcrMiner64.exe, version: 0.0.0.0, time stamp: 0x58c7fc9f
Exception code: 0xc0000094
Fault offset: 0x0000000000002c93
Faulting process id: 0x3208
Faulting application start time: 0x01d2ab0fe4cf8a62
Faulting application path: E:\Ethereum\Claymore\EthDcrMiner64.exe
Faulting module path: E:\Ethereum\Claymore\EthDcrMiner64.exe
Report Id: 05edb991-dfbc-4861-b053-877f3c549762
Faulting package full name:
Faulting package-relative application ID:

and then says the program crashed. I have 17.3.2 AMD driver. Latest Windows 10. Is there any further logs I can add?

This started happening to me when I disabled the onboard graphics in the device manager. I re-enabled and it started working.
